Muddy Waters - Deep Blues (Guitar Recorded Versions) [Paperback] Review

Muddy Waters - Deep Blues [Paperback]This collection of guitar transcriptions from the recorded works of Muddy Waters is, simply, a must have for any blues guitarist.In fact, any musician with an interest in fundamental American recorded music will findthis document to be a primary text for Chicago Blues, the development ofthe electic guitar, and the basic beginnings of American (and Brit) rock nroll.
Muddy Waters: Deep Bluescontains guitar transcriptions from 31songs performed and recorded by Waters and his sidemen from 1948's "ICan't Be Satisfied" to "Sad, Sad Day" off a 1981 session w/Johnny Winter.Studying these transcriptions has given me - a mediocreamateur - new insights into the varied styles of the famous sidemen likeJimmy Rogers and Buddy Guy and a newfound excitement in the discovery ofsome lesser-known and under-rated guitar gods.The transcription of EarlHooker's shimmering guitar on "You Shook Me" (1962) is aparticular treasure.
A general outline of Muddy's guitar style isexcellent; there are explanations of the Delta open G tuning, use of theslide, and illustrative samples of how other musicians treat Muddy's stylein their own fashions.This one of the most enjoyable and useful books ofmusic that I have ever encountered.
